Often, the most common problem with myQ garage door openers involves connectivity. This can stem from Wi-Fi signal interference in dense urban areas like Washington, or issues with the opener's internal receiver. Sometimes, a simple reset of both the opener and your home's Wi-Fi can resolve the problem. We can diagnose if it's a signal issue or a hardware malfunction.
